Steroids copyright: Risks and Consequences

The temptation of enhanced performance has led many in copyright to explore the realm of anabolic steroids. While these substances can offer a sudden boost, they come with a hefty price tag: serious risks. Abuse of steroids can wreak havoc on your overall health, leading to issues like liver damage, cardiovascular disease, and even emotional disturbances. It's crucial to understand that the likely gains don't outweigh the inherent dangers.

Canadian Bodybuilding Supplements: Are They Safe?

Navigating the world of products can be a real challenge. When it comes to Canadian bodybuilding supplements, the question check here of safety often lingers in the minds of athletes and fitness enthusiasts alike. While many reputable brands operate within copyright, adhering to strict regulations and quality control measures, there's always a risk of encountering less scrupulous sellers. Sourcing products from unreliable sources can expose you to potential health hazards. Before you commit to any product, it's crucial to investigate its ingredients thoroughly and consult a healthcare professional, especially if you have pre-existing medical conditions or are taking other medications.

  • Always purchase supplements from reputable retailers who prioritize quality and transparency.
  • Read ingredient labels carefully and look for third-party certifications, such as NSF or Informed Sport.
  • Be wary of products with unrealistic claims or promises of quick results.
  • If you experience any adverse effects after using a supplement, discontinue use and seek medical attention immediately.

By staying informed and exercising caution, you can minimize the risks associated with Canadian bodybuilding supplements and guarantee your safety while pursuing your fitness goals.

Steroid Laws in copyright

Navigating the legal framework surrounding steroids in copyright can be difficult. While steroids are generally banned for use in sport and athletics, their legal status outside of this context is variable. Possession and sale of steroids without a valid prescription from a medical professional can result in criminal charges under the Controlled Drugs and Substances Act. However, individual consumption may not always be subject to the same level of harsh consequences.

  • Ultimately, the legal ramifications of steroid use in copyright can vary depending on a number of factors, including the specific circumstances, quantities involved, and intent.
  • Individuals considering using steroids should consult with a legal professional to fully understand the potential risks.
